Document Summary

Obesity is a disease and leads to other diseases like diabetes, cancer, heart problems, and an earlier death. Fat bodies are an economic burden on society. Fat bodies should lose weight to conform to the normal . Fatness is linked to a sociocultural disadvantage, obesogenic environment, consumerist culture. Drug companies, diet product producers, bariatrics surgeons profiting. Linkage between weight gain and links between mortality are unclear. How much people weigh has gone up. Oliver believed it"s the spreading of an idea. Kathleen lebesco - moral panics: marked by concern about an imagined threat. Hostility in the form of a mortal outrage towards individuals and agencies responsible for the problem. It is consensus that something must be done about the threat. Seeing the obese body as diseased leads to us as seeing fat people as less than human. Headless fatties news reports and pictures of headless overweight people leads to us to be less empathetic.
